Miltona Bay Estates: frequently asked questions
Is Miltona Bay Estates's water safe to drink?
Miltona Bay Estates is an active transient non-community water system regulated under the Safe Drinking Water Act, overseen by the MN state drinking water program. EPA SDWA violation and enforcement records for this system are being added to AquaCensus from EPA ECHO; consult EPA ECHO or your annual Consumer Confidence Report for its current compliance status.
Who runs Miltona Bay Estates?
Miltona Bay Estates (PWSID MN5210416) is a private-owned transient non-community water system, regulated by the MN state drinking water program.
How many people does Miltona Bay Estates serve?
Miltona Bay Estates reports serving 50 people through 2 service connections in Douglas County, Minnesota.
Where does Miltona Bay Estates get its water?
EPA SDWIS lists this system's primary water source as groundwater.
